      What's interesting is that Maxx Force cheats by barely getting you passed 135 degrees 3 times, and barely pulling you out of the inversion a couple times to try and pad the inversion count, and rcdb doesn't cry foul on those. But when Steel Curtain kind of does it, rcdb cries foul and robs them of an inversion. If Maxx Force has 5, then not only does Steel Curtain have 9, but Storm Chaser has 3 (overbank over 135 degrees), and Iron Gwazi has 3 (overbank over 135 degrees). If rcdb was just as harsh on Maxx Force, it would only have 2 inversions.
